Verbes irréguliers
 
Infinitif : to forget ... Prétérit: forgot ... Participe passé : forgotten  ... traduction : Oublier
Infinitif : to get ... prétérit : got ... participe passé : got ... traduction : obtenir
Infinitif : to tell ... prétérit : told ... participe passé : told ... traduction : dire, raconter
Infinitif : to send ... prétérit : sent ... participe passé : sent ... traduction : envoyer
Infinitif : to make ... prétérit : made ... participe passé : made ... traduction : faire, fabriquer
Infinitif : to freeze ... prétérit : froze ... participe passé : frozen ... traduction : geler
Infinitif : to know ... prétérit : knew ... participe passé : known ... traduction : savoir, connaître
Infinitif : to feel ... prétérit : felt ... participe passé : felt ... traduction : (se) sentir
Infinitif : to speak ... prétérit : spoke ... participe passé : spoken ... traduction : parler
Infinitif : to be ... prétérit : was / were ... participe passé : been ... traduction : être
Infinitif : have to ... prétérit : had to ... participe passé : had to ... traduction : être obligé de
Infinitif : to see ... prétérit : saw ... participe passé : seen ... traduction : voir
 
Attention : Get - 1er sens "OBTENIR" quand on le trouve seul
Ex : I got a 20/20 in English
 
- 2ème sens avec "HAVE" : have got = on ne le traduit pas
Ex : I have got two sisters
 
- 3ème sens: To get + Adj. = devenir
Ex : I'm getting angry = je deviens en colère = je m'énerve

We also corrected the exercise on CAN'T- MUST and MAY
CAN'T: Impossibilité
MUST: Quasi certitude
MAY: Eventualité
